[QUOTE="Paul%20FOD:114214"]Virulence was simple the best band from boston ever. Dormant strains killed when it first came out. A conflict scenerio was probably the most technical, twisted and original death metal/fusion cd to ever come out. This band played a huge influence on my playing and my look at music in general. Live was even more intense for these guys. So tight and so brutal it was amazing. IF you like virulence I suggest you also check out "incarrion" that was nicks band prior to virulence I believe. The guitar work for incarrion is also amazing. Rev I like pillory but I wouldnt even call them a new Virulence. Id say they are a different style very intense but not as vile or interesting as virulence. El Justin good luck finding the virulence discs. I believe roger from mortician has a few copies of Dormant strains for sale and im sure you might be able to find A conflict scenerio from some distro maybe razorback records? But if you find those BUY THEM. [/QUOTE]
